Hi all, I picked this up on a chance, not exactly sure of its legitimacy. I'm leaning towards GAR kepi with 31 being the post number in some state. It was advertised as a 1870-80s Indian War kepi however. From what I can tell, it matches a model 1872 kepi but I'm unfamiliar with the specifics and standards of how there were 'adorned,' i.e. unit numbers, branch insignia, etc. Any ideas? I would say the crossed sabers, buttons and gold cord where added well after the fact (to increase collector interest). The kepi itself could be a veteran, militia, or state unit. No way to tell for sure. 1870's/80's would seem correct for era. Hopefully you didn't pay a "Indian Wars Kepi" price.
